On 28/2/20 12:04, Orion Poplawski wrote:
I'm unable to build ParaView on armv7hl:
[ 14%] Building CXX object
VTK/Accelerators/Vtkm/CMakeFiles/AcceleratorsVTKm.dir/vtkmClip.cxx.o
cd
/builddir/build/BUILD/ParaView-v5.8.0/armv7hl-redhat-linux-gnueabi/VTK/Accelerators/Vtkm
&& /usr/bin/c++ -DAcceleratorsVTKm_EXPORTS
-I/builddir/build/BUILD/ParaView-v5.8.0/armv7hl-redhat-linux-gnueabi/VTK/Accelerators/Vtkm
-I/builddir/build/BUILD/ParaView-v5.8.0/VTK/Accelerators/Vtkm
-I/builddir/build/BUILD/ParaView-v5.8.0/armv7hl-redhat-linux-gnueabi/VTK/Common/Core
-I/builddir/build/BUILD/ParaView-v5.8.0/VTK/Common/Core
-I/builddir/build/BUILD/ParaView-v5.8.0/armv7hl-redhat-linux-gnueabi/VTK/Common/DataModel
-I/builddir/build/BUILD/ParaView-v5.8.0/VTK/Common/DataModel
-I/builddir/build/BUILD/ParaView-v5.8.0/armv7hl-redhat-linux-gnueabi/VTK/Common/Math
-I/builddir/build/BUILD/ParaView-v5.8.0/VTK/Common/Math
-I/builddir/build/BUILD/ParaView-v5.8.0/armv7hl-redhat-linux-gnueabi/VTK/Common/Transforms
-I/builddir/build/BUILD/ParaView-v5.8.0/VTK/Common/Transforms
-I/builddir/build/BUILD/ParaView-v5.8.0/armv7hl-redhat-linux-gnueabi/VTK/Common/ExecutionModel
-I/builddir/build/BUILD/ParaView-v5.8.0/VTK/Common/ExecutionModel
-I/builddir/build/BUILD/ParaView-v5.8.0/armv7hl-redhat-linux-gnueabi/VTK/Filters/General
-I/builddir/build/BUILD/ParaView-v5.8.0/VTK/Filters/General
-I/builddir/build/BUILD/ParaView-v5.8.0/armv7hl-redhat-linux-gnueabi/VTK/Common/Misc
-I/builddir/build/BUILD/ParaView-v5.8.0/VTK/Common/Misc
-I/builddir/build/BUILD/ParaView-v5.8.0/armv7hl-redhat-linux-gnueabi/VTK/Filters/Core
-I/builddir/build/BUILD/ParaView-v5.8.0/VTK/Filters/Core
-I/builddir/build/BUILD/ParaView-v5.8.0/armv7hl-redhat-linux-gnueabi/VTK/Filters/Geometry
-I/builddir/build/BUILD/ParaView-v5.8.0/VTK/Filters/Geometry
-I/builddir/build/BUILD/ParaView-v5.8.0/armv7hl-redhat-linux-gnueabi/VTK/Imaging/Core
-I/builddir/build/BUILD/ParaView-v5.8.0/VTK/Imaging/Core
-I/builddir/build/BUILD/ParaView-v5.8.0/armv7hl-redhat-linux-gnueabi/VTK/ThirdParty/vtkm/vtkvtkm
-I/builddir/build/BUILD/ParaView-v5.8.0/VTK/ThirdParty/vtkm/vtkvtkm
-I/builddir/build/BUILD/ParaView-v5.8.0/VTK/ThirdParty/vtkm/vtkvtkm/vtk-m
-I/builddir/build/BUILD/ParaView-v5.8.0/armv7hl-redhat-linux-gnueabi/VTK/ThirdParty/vtkm/vtkvtkm/vtk-m/include
-I/builddir/build/BUILD/ParaView-v5.8.0/VTK/ThirdParty/vtkm/vtkvtkm/vtk-m/vtkm/thirdparty/taotuple
-I/builddir/build/BUILD/ParaView-v5.8.0/VTK/ThirdParty/vtkm/vtkvtkm/vtk-m/vtkm/thirdparty/optionparser
-I/builddir/build/BUILD/ParaView-v5.8.0/VTK/ThirdParty/vtkm/vtkvtkm/vtk-m/vtkm/thirdparty/diy
-I/builddir/build/BUILD/ParaView-v5.8.0/VTK/ThirdParty/vtkm/vtkvtkm/vtk-m/vtkm/thirdparty/lcl/vtkmlcl
-isystem
/builddir/build/BUILD/ParaView-v5.8.0/armv7hl-redhat-linux-gnueabi/VTK/Utilities/KWIML
-isystem /builddir/build/BUILD/ParaView-v5.8.0/VTK/Utilities/KWIML
-isystem
/builddir/build/BUILD/ParaView-v5.8.0/armv7hl-redhat-linux-gnueabi/VTK/Utilities/KWSys
-isystem /builddir/build/BUILD/ParaView-v5.8.0/VTK/Utilities/KWSys
-isystem
/builddir/build/BUILD/ParaView-v5.8.0/armv7hl-redhat-linux-gnueabi/VTK/ThirdParty/vtkm
-isystem /builddir/build/BUILD/ParaView-v5.8.0/VTK/ThirdParty/vtkm
-O2 -g -pipe -Wall -Werror=format-security -Wp,-D_FORTIFY_SOURCE=2
-Wp,-D_GLIBCXX_ASSERTIONS -fexceptions -fstack-protector-strong
-grecord-gcc-switches -specs=/usr/lib/rpm/redhat/redhat-hardened-cc1
-specs=/usr/lib/rpm/redhat/redhat-annobin-cc1 -fcommon -march=armv7-a
-mfpu=vfpv3-d16 -mtune=generic-armv7-a -mabi=aapcs-linux
-mfloat-abi=hard -O2 -g -DNDEBUG -fPIC -fvisibility=hidden
-fvisibility-inlines-hidden -ffunction-sections -std=c++11 -o
CMakeFiles/AcceleratorsVTKm.dir/vtkmClip.cxx.o -c
/builddir/build/BUILD/ParaView-v5.8.0/VTK/Accelerators/Vtkm/vtkmClip.cxx
virtual memory exhausted: Operation not permitted
I have already reduced the make parallelism to 1, so not sure what
else I can do to avoid this other than to exclude it (which I'm
probably happy to do). Suggestions welcome.
Something like this
https://src.fedoraproject.org/rpms/nodejs/c/0217ef1931929f05d069c7281b713...
_______________________________________________
devel mailing list -- devel(a)lists.fedoraproject.org
To unsubscribe send an email to devel-leave(a)lists.fedoraproject.org
Fedora Code of Conduct:
https://docs.fedoraproject.org/en-US/project/code-of-conduct/
List Guidelines:
https://fedoraproject.org/wiki/Mailing_list_guidelines
List Archives:
https://lists.fedoraproject.org/archives/list/devel@lists.fedoraproject.org